The group exhibition A Matter of Perception gathers together works that serve to call attention to the “stuff” that constitutes the art object, the material and perceptual qualities of the media deployed––its construction and its components. The art on view is, in and of itself, an invitation to observe, to contemplate, to engage in reveries....

Artists: Debbie Adamson, Jon Cox, Wesley John Fourie, Jackson Harry, Matthew Trubuhović
